The project in detail

Welland, February 15, 2025. SOFIFRAN is pleased to announce that it has received a grant of $362,391 through the Women’s Program of Women and Gender Equality Canada. This funding will allow our organization to carry out the project “Building capacity to meet the needs of women in Niagara”. This 18-month project aims to strengthen SOFIFRAN’s ability to promote gender equality and to address the specific challenges facing francophone immigrant women in the Niagara region. It will be built around several areas of work: in-depth research, an external analysis, and community consultations to better understand what these women are living through and to identify the priority actions to take, using a GBA Plus approach. Key activities will include developing a strategic plan, building partnerships and training the SOFIFRAN team, in particular in mental health, digital tools and computer software. A thorough evaluation will also be carried out to measure the impact of the project and follow its progress.
